COLUMBIA -- Elected and municipal officials along with other community, nonprofit and business leaders from the Beaufort region will discuss issues involving shoreline change management at the Beaufort Community Leaders’ Forum on Shoreline Change June 22 at the Technical College of the Lowcountry, the state Department of Health and Environmental Control reported today.
Topics will include implications of chronic erosion, gradual sea level rise, increased shoreline development and comprehensive beachfront management planning. A public comment period will begin at 5:30 p.m.
Organized by DHEC in 2007, the Shoreline Change Advisory Committee is an advisory committee of a broad cross-section of stakeholders including scientists, coastal managers, municipal officials, developers, conservationists and legal professionals. The committee’s purpose is to organize existing shoreline research, identify research priority needs and consider policy-related issues concerning management of South Carolina’s estuarine and beachfront shorelines. A report of the committee’s findings is planned for late 2009.
The Beaufort Community Leaders’ Forum on Shoreline Change is organized by DHEC’s Office of Ocean and Coastal Resource Management in partnership with South Carolina Sea Grant Consortium, the Town of Hilton Head Island, the ACE Basin National Estuarine Research Reserve and the Beaufort Regional Chamber of Commerce.
